Mona Brorsson’s words about what it’s like to work with Björn Ferry

When Mona Brorsson was recruited to SVT as a biathlon expert for the season, Björn Ferry had already worked there for ten years.
Now she reveals that she was a little nervous about meeting him in the new workplace.
– I didn’t know him at all and haven’t really had much to do with him during my career, she tells the Sports Bible.

A couple of weeks before last year’s season was over the biathlon announced Mona Brorsson34, that she intended to put the rifle and skis on the shelf. Her main merit as a rider is her Olympic gold in relay from Beijing 2022 as well as the silver medals from the Olympics (2018) and the World Cup (2019), also those in relay.

When the former biathlon Helena Ekholm40, chose to give up his role as an expert in SVT’s winter studio after six years, it was for many obvious that Mona would take over. She describes herself how the channel contacted her early on and asked if she was craving.
– It feels like SVT almost had no choice because there were so many from the outside who pressed. So I got the question and it was pretty easy to say yes. They then said: “It is clear that we will try this”. I was down one day and did a test broadcast along with Ola Bränholm. So we tried to comment and got to sit with Yvette Hermundstad in the studio and “play” Winter Studio. I didn’t completely do away with it because I had to come back, she tells the Sports Bible.

Another former Olympic hero who also feeds himself as a biathlon expert in the Winter Studio is Björn Ferry46. He has more or less worked for SVT since he ended his career in 2014. For many he is the face out for the winter studio, possibly together with André PopsThe Jacob Hård and Anders Blomquist. Now Mona Brorsson tells us what it was like to start working with him.
– Yes, so surprisingly good really. I don’t know Björn before. He ended in 2014 and I did my first World Cup season in 2013. But at that time the men’s team and the women’s team were separated. But I had to go some competitions where he was there, but then I did not know him at all and have not really had much to do with him during my career, she says.

Ferry can sometimes be perceived as quite determined, honest and straight – and is not afraid to criticize when needed – but always with the twinkle in the eye. He is a very respected and popular person. Therefore, Mona Brorsson was still a little excited for the first meeting.

– Maybe I was a little nervous about: “How is this going to go? How is he? ”. But it feels like we complement each other very well. Because you do not want me to come in and be exactly the same. Or that it would not work. That you have no type of personal chemistry at all. But I really think it has worked the top, that we have been able to complement each other and had very interesting discussions and got a great flow in the talk. So it has been fun and very grateful too, because he is very helpful too. Come on tips and advice and tried to make me feel welcome, Mona tells the Sports Bible.
